On this weeks show (what show!) We're joined by the Godfather of analog phtography podcasting,  the ever entertaining Michael Raso. Founder and Captain of the illustrious Film Photography Podcast, and creator of the Film Photography Project, which has worked to make films and film formats that might otherwise be hard to come by readily available for photographers, and has provided hundreds of cameras to schools through it's donation project.  As well as the FPP they discuss Michaels many years work in the film and video industry as a producer and creator, and much more   Find the Film Photography Project in all these places: https://filmphotographyproject.com/ https://twitter.com/filmpodcast https://www.facebook.com/FilmPhotographyPodcast https://www.instagram.com/filmphotographyproject/?hl=en https://www.youtube.com/user/FilmPhotographyTube   Learn more about Michaels work on old films here:http://alternativecinema.blogspot.com/2010/04/interview-with-michael-raso-archive.html Links from show:  Rachels artist residency: https://www.wirral.gov.uk/libraries-and-archives/make-it-0  Submission for polaroid photo calendar open = http://c4e.slanted.de/photodarium-2020 Our friend J.M.
